Understanding the Forex Market Hours and Recent Changes

The Four Major Forex Trading Sessions Explored
- Asian Session (Tokyo): Opening at 00:00 GMT and closing around 09:00 GMT, this session initiates the day’s currency movements, often influenced by economic data from Japan, China, and Australia.
- European Session (London): Operating from 08:00 GMT to 17:00 GMT, it is historically the most liquid and volatile market window, driven by major financial institutions and economic releases from the Eurozone and UK.
- North American Session (New York): From 13:00 GMT to 22:00 GMT, this session overlaps with London’s close for a few hours, creating optimal conditions for high-volume trading.
- Pacific and Other Regional Hours: Other centers such as Sydney, Singapore, and Dubai have contributed to evolving forex liquidity patterns, with their session timings shifting in response to daylight savings changes and local trading regulations.

How Changing Forex Market Hours Affect Trading Strategies

Timing Volatility Peaks to Maximize Profit
Traders traditionally exploit overlapping market sessions to maximize liquidity and volatility. With evolving operational hours, timing these windows is crucial for optimized entry and exit points. For example:
- London-New York Overlap: Though now slightly shortened in 2025, this remains the prime window for executing high-frequency and large-volume trades due to heightened market activity.
- Asian-European Transitions: New liquidity surges have emerged, offering opportunities for swing traders who leverage less crowded but volatile price movements.
Risks Linked To Altered Market Hours
With schedule variability, some risks traders must proactively manage include:
- Gaps in Liquidity: Shortened overlaps can reduce available counterparties, potentially increasing bid-ask spreads and slippage.
- Unexpected Price Swings: Reduced trading during transitional hours increases vulnerability to price gaps caused by geopolitical events or macroeconomic surprises.
- Extended Market Exposure: Traders holding positions beyond typical session hours face greater overnight risk, underscoring the need for robust risk management.

How do changes in forex market hours affect currency pair volatility?
Session overlaps, especially between London and New York, traditionally drive peak volatility. When overlaps shorten or shift, volatility concentrates within narrower windows, potentially causing sharp price movements to occur more suddenly. Conversely, thin volume during off-peak hours can increase spreads and slippage risk.
Which forex pairs benefit most from trading within high-liquidity market hours?
Major pairs like EUR/USD, GBP/USD, and USD/JPY typically exhibit maximal liquidity and tight spreads during London-New York overlaps. Emerging market currencies or regional pairs may benefit from session overlaps involving their home trading centers, such as the AUD/USD during the Asian session.
